Background & Context

Historically, cartoons have been used as a tool for expressing political and social opinions. Since the 19th century, this art form has played a significant role in shaping public opinion, highlighting important issues. In modern times, cartoons have become more diverse, addressing multiple topics related to the contemporary world.

In recent years, there has been an increase in the use of cartoons as a means of expressing protests and political stances. In many countries, these artworks are considered part of popular culture, circulated through social media, thereby enhancing their impact.
